Output 34de3a1609713f19e5d159802478b208bb6974b33035994199d6a7aa72bbbf69:12

value
905879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04d2179f7cc2a049e2b1b1864db54a2ec0a8fa8 OP_EQUAL
address
3HmDFSoAVfpGP4hoGjHosUNoZoZFbZPcke
transaction
34de3a1609713f19e5d159802478b208bb6974b33035994199d6a7aa72bbbf69